The Iowa football program is continuing to put in work on its 2027 recruiting class.
The Hawkeyes are up to seven commitments in their 2027 class now after picking up four pledges over the past couple of weeks. They've added some talent along both lines of scrimmage, in the secondary, and at the tight end position. Now, they've turned their attention to the most important position in all of sports: quarterback.
Iowa is in the mix for 2027 four-star quarterback Jake Nawrot, who's highly sought-after by other elite programs. However, that's not the only signal-caller the Hawkeyes are after in this class. On Tuesday, three-star Brayden Santibanez announced that he's received an offer from Iowa.

Santibanez is from Collierville, Tenn., and Collierville High School. The 6-foot-2, 205-pound quarterback is the 73rd-ranked quarterback and No. 43 player out of Tennessee in the 2027 class, according to 247Sports. He currently holds offers from 20 schools, including Maryland, North Carolina, Boston College, and Cincinnati.
Santibanez split reps at the quarterback position for Collierville as a junior in 2025, completing 66% of his passes for 1,140 yards and 13 touchdowns. He also added 321 yards and five touchdowns on the ground, showing off a dual-threat skillset. He's in line to be the full-time starter as a senior in 2026, which should continue to elevate his stock throughout the fall.
The Hawkeyes see a lot of potential in Santibanez, as they didn't just offer him a scholarship on Tuesday. The very next day, they locked down an official visit weekend for him: June 12-14.

With offensive coordinator Tim Lester entering his third season in Iowa City and an improved offense over the past couple of years, high school quarterbacks are showing much more interest in the program. Iowa now has a good recruiting pitch to those guys and should see better results in the recruiting game, potentially beginning with Santibanez.
